Output 67cc51b7d9d321cc8d65190f0ecfaaf3ce6a53d27e006bc0ab4bce3d15aac311:0

value
25098384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4bf4d2ac373d42765303958bdfd394b9fb4d0d OP_EQUAL
address
3BkDFBdZJgEQLzZvHRB3npMhufTkHSYqJP
transaction
67cc51b7d9d321cc8d65190f0ecfaaf3ce6a53d27e006bc0ab4bce3d15aac311
spent
true